12.2: wie grup2 anpassen?
Hallo zusammen, Ich habe meine 12.2 Installation über das Grub1 Menü gestartet und dabei einen Update gemacht. Dabei ist auch der Kernel aktualisiert worden. In dem Grub1 Menu habe ich auch einen Eintrag, mit dem ich das Grub2 Menü, das sich in der Root Partition von /dev/sdc2 befindet, starten kann. Aber das meldet jetzt nur, dass ich doch erst den Kernel laden soll. Beim Update wurde anscheinend im Grub2 die Kerneländerungen nicht aktualisiert. Mit YAST2 komme ich an den Eintrag aber auch nicht ran. Hat ja kürzlich hier schon jemand angemerkt, dass man in YAST2 immer nur an den Grub2 Eintrag des gerade gebooteten Systems herankommt. Wie kann ich jetzt die Grub2 Einträge wieder reparieren ? Danke für 'nen Tipp. Grüße Werner Franke -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um den Listen Administrator zu erreichen, schicken Sie eine Mail an: opensuse-de+owner@opensuse.org
Werner Franke wrote:
Ich habe meine 12.2 Installation über das Grub1 Menü gestartet und dabei einen Update gemacht. Dabei ist auch der Kernel aktualisiert worden.
In dem Grub1 Menu habe ich auch einen Eintrag, mit dem ich das Grub2 Menü, das sich in der Root Partition von /dev/sdc2 befindet, starten kann.
Aber das meldet jetzt nur, dass ich doch erst den Kernel laden soll. Beim Update wurde anscheinend im Grub2 die Kerneländerungen nicht aktualisiert. Mit YAST2 komme ich an den Eintrag aber auch nicht ran.
Wenn du die diversen Einträge in den diversen Readme's zu grub2 liest wirst du feststellen das (bisher) Kernelupdates NIE das grub2 Menu aktualisieren. Das musst du bisher immer von Hand machen: grub2-mkconfig -o /boot/grub2/grub.cfg (Ob das irgendwo in yast geht kann ich dir nicht sagen; ich benutze yast so gut wie gar nicht) Andreas--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um den Listen Administrator zu erreichen, schicken Sie eine Mail an: opensuse-de+owner@opensuse.org
Hi Andreas, Am 22.10.2012 09:37, schrieb Kyek, Andreas, Vodafone DE:
Werner Franke wrote:
Ich habe meine 12.2 Installation über das Grub1 Menü gestartet und dabei einen Update gemacht. Dabei ist auch der Kernel aktualisiert worden.
In dem Grub1 Menu habe ich auch einen Eintrag, mit dem ich das Grub2 Menü, das sich in der Root Partition von /dev/sdc2 befindet, starten kann.
Aber das meldet jetzt nur, dass ich doch erst den Kernel laden soll. Beim Update wurde anscheinend im Grub2 die Kerneländerungen nicht aktualisiert. Mit YAST2 komme ich an den Eintrag aber auch nicht ran.
Wenn du die diversen Einträge in den diversen Readme's zu grub2 liest wirst du feststellen das (bisher) Kernelupdates NIE das grub2 Menu aktualisieren. Das musst du bisher immer von Hand machen:
grub2-mkconfig -o /boot/grub2/grub.cfg
(Ob das irgendwo in yast geht kann ich dir nicht sagen; ich benutze yast so gut wie gar nicht)
Danke. Ich werde mir das mal genauer ansehen (müssen). Irgendwie fühle ich mich bei Grub2 wieder in die Zeit von LILO zurückversetzt. Gruss Werner -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um den Listen Administrator zu erreichen, schicken Sie eine Mail an: opensuse-de+owner@opensuse.org
für GRUB2 Spielereien kannst du dieses Repo einbinden: http://software.opensuse.org/package/kcm-grub2 und ebendieses "kcm-grub2" installieren. Dann hst du in YaST (oder auch Systemsettings) eine hübsche graphische Oberfläche. Mag sein, dass dir das den schon genannten update Befehl NICHT erspart, aber die Konfiguration ist doch etws übersichtlicher. Gruß Kalle aka }ls{ @ irc -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um den Listen Administrator zu erreichen, schicken Sie eine Mail an: opensuse-de+owner@opensuse.org
Hallo Kalle, Am 10/22/2012 02:38 PM, schrieb Kalle Schmidt:
für GRUB2 Spielereien kannst du dieses Repo einbinden: http://software.opensuse.org/package/kcm-grub2 und ebendieses "kcm-grub2" installieren.
Dann hst du in YaST (oder auch Systemsettings) eine hübsche graphische Oberfläche.
Mag sein, dass dir das den schon genannten update Befehl NICHT erspart, aber die Konfiguration ist doch etws übersichtlicher.
Wahrscheinlich stelle ich mich nur blöd an, aber... Auf der Seite von oben wird zwar oben "kcm-grub2" gross angezeigt, aber was ich da jetzt machen muss, ist mir unklar. Wenn ich auf "openSUSE 12.2" klicke wird mir der Text "Show unstable packages" angezeigt. Ein Klick darauf und abnicken der folgenden Warnung bekomme ich die Liste: home:Marcisaccount 1 Click Install home:deanjo13 1 Click Install home:deltafox 1 Click Install home:ecsos 1 Click Install home:ksmanis 1 Click Install und jetzt ? Danke und Gruss Werner -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um den Listen Administrator zu erreichen, schicken Sie eine Mail an: opensuse-de+owner@opensuse.org
Hallo, Am Dienstag 23 Oktober 2012 schrieb Werner Franke: snip
home:Marcisaccount 1 Click Install home:deanjo13 1 Click Install home:deltafox 1 Click Install home:ecsos 1 Click Install home:ksmanis 1 Click Install
Jetzt musst du dich für einen von den Burschen entscheiden und einen beherzten Mauslinksklick auf das entsprechende "1 Click Install" machen. Ab hier sollte eine Std-Installation starten, bei der auch das eine oder andere abgenickt werden muss. -- Mit freundlichen Grüßen Matthias Müller (Benutzer #439779 im Linux-Counter http://counter.li.org) PS: Bitte senden Sie als Antwort auf meine E-Mails reine Text-Nachrichten!
Hallo Andreas, Am 10/22/2012 09:37 AM, schrieb Kyek, Andreas, Vodafone DE:
Werner Franke wrote:
Ich habe meine 12.2 Installation über das Grub1 Menü gestartet und dabei einen Update gemacht. Dabei ist auch der Kernel aktualisiert worden.
[...]
Aber das meldet jetzt nur, dass ich doch erst den Kernel laden soll. Beim Update wurde anscheinend im Grub2 die Kerneländerungen nicht aktualisiert. Mit YAST2 komme ich an den Eintrag aber auch nicht ran.
Wenn du die diversen Einträge in den diversen Readme's zu grub2 liest wirst du feststellen das (bisher) Kernelupdates NIE das grub2 Menu aktualisieren. Das musst du bisher immer von Hand machen:
grub2-mkconfig -o /boot/grub2/grub.cfg
(Ob das irgendwo in yast geht kann ich dir nicht sagen; ich benutze yast so gut wie gar nicht)
Ich habe es nun gestern, so wie Du es vorgeschlagen hast, versucht. Folgendes merkwürdiges Resultat: root@obelix (-bash) grub2-mkconfig -o /boot/grub2/grub.cfg /etc/default/grub: line 5: seconds: command not found root@obelix (-bash) more /etc/default/grub # This Source Code Form is subject to the terms of the Mozilla Public # License, v. 2.0. If a copy of the MPL was not distributed with this # file, You can obtain one at http://mozilla.org/MPL/2.0/. seconds = segundo;segundos minutes = minuto;minutos hours = hora;horas : : root@obelix (-bash) ll /etc/default/grub* -rw-r--r-- 2 root root 4677 Oct 12 13:19 grub -rw------- 1 root root 1804 Oct 17 19:43 grub.old -rw-r--r-- 1 root root 1139 Jul 30 20:43 grub.rpmnew -rw------- 1 root root 70 Oct 17 22:53 grub_installdevice -rw------- 1 root root 70 Oct 17 19:43 grub_installdevice.old root@obelix (-bash) mv grub grub.MIST root@obelix (-bash) mv grub.rpmnew grub root@obelix (-bash) grub2-mkconfig -o /boot/grub2/grub.cfg Generating grub.cfg ... Found linux image: /boot/vmlinuz-3.4.11-2.16-desktop Found initrd image: /boot/initrd-3.4.11-2.16-desktop No volume groups found Found openSUSE 12.1 (x86_64) on /dev/sda1 Found openSUSE 12.1 (x86_64) on /dev/sdb1 Found openSUSE 12.1 (x86_64) on /dev/sdc1 done Nachdem ich also das falsche /etc/default/grub umbenannt hatte, hat es funktioniert. Allerdings habe ich jetzt nur noch eine Textversion des Grub2 Menüs ohne grünen Hintergrund. Was aber wichtiger ist: Woher kam das Mozilla /etc/default/grub ?? Gruss Werner -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um den Listen Administrator zu erreichen, schicken Sie eine Mail an: opensuse-de+owner@opensuse.org
participants (4)
-
Kalle Schmidt
-
Kyek, Andreas, Vodafone DE
-
Matthias Müller
-
Werner Franke